Transaction 5820946714db561b97486d8096a32e108d1a45d84f74e8becde2c3e15102f311

3 Input
2 Outputs
  • 5820946714db561b97486d8096a32e108d1a45d84f74e8becde2c3e15102f311:0
  • value  671040
    address  1FcvafTKkYYL3kXB6YTmxDcMzqy5nJSRe8
  • 5820946714db561b97486d8096a32e108d1a45d84f74e8becde2c3e15102f311:1
  • value  6931800
    address  3LR6MSgJmzEBhgW1MzuaUtTy2WN8aQ9Be9